Major in History


 

Requirements for a Major in History: 42 credits including:

HI 103 & HI 104 & HI 105            World Civilization I & II & III

HI 111 & HI 112                         US History I & II


US History electives: 6 credits

European History electives: 6 credits

Area Studies electives: 6 credits
One other elective in history, which can be from the “General” category: 3 credits
Two (2) of the above electives must be at the 300 or 400 level

Course in historical methods, to be taken during sophomore or junior year: 3 credits HI 411 The Historian’s Craft (Prerequisites: HI 103, 104, 111 and 112) or HI 440 Internship (with departmental approval)

Senior capstone experience, usually taken during Fall of your senior year: 3 credits HI 460 Senior Research Seminar in History, or HI 470 Senior Thesis in History. If you are an Education double-major, the senior capstone may be fulfilled by submission of a History Learning Portfolio based on your student teaching experience.
